루빗-React Native 프론트엔드 개발자
루빗-React Native 프론트엔드 개발자
1/2
루빗서울 영등포구경력 3-10년

React Native 프론트엔드 개발자

포지션 상세

글로벌 [230만 셀프케어 앱 - 루빗 / AI Companion 앱 - loody]의 앱 사용성을 고도화할 프론트엔드 개발자를 모십니다.

[기업 소개]
글로벌 200만 명이 사용하는 앱 ‘루빗’과 차세대 AI Companion ‘loody’를 만들고 있는 ‘루빗’팀입니다 :)
저희 팀은 ‘사람들이 건강하고, 행복한 일상을 유지하고 더 나아가게 만들자’를 비전으로 달려가고 있습니다.
특히 외로움, 무기력, 우울감 등 정신적 건강과 하루의 행복을 도와주는 서비스를 만들고 있습니다.
글로벌 B2C 비즈니스에 특화된 팀으로 전세계 사람들이 기술적 혁신을 통해 행복하고 만족스러운 하루를 살아가도록 돕습니다.

[제품 소개]
1. loody: 하루의 시작부터 끝까지 나를 관리해주는 AI 앱, 디바이스입니다.
점점 개인화된 사회로 가며, 인간은 누구나 위로받을 수 있는 존재가 필요합니다.
AI는 점점 사람다워지고, 미래에는 사람같은 AI는 먼 이야기가 아닙니다.
우리는 AI와 함께 살아가는 세상에 들어설 것이며, loody는 그 미래에서 가장 사랑 받는 Companion 서비스가 되고자 합니다.
외로운 사람을 위한 AI로 시작해서, 더 나아가 인류 전체에 기여할 수 있는 제품으로 만들고자 합니다.
*현재 주력으로 집중하는 신규 프로젝트 입니다.

2. 루빗: 누구나 건강한 일상을 누릴 수 있는 세상을 꿈꾸며
매일 루틴과 마음을 관리할수 있도록 도와주는 셀프케어 앱입니다
[매일의 루틴과 마음을 관리해주는 친구] '루빗'을 만들고 있어요.
루틴 관리를 시작으로 마음 건강 등 일상의 다양한 범위로 확장해 건강한 일상을 만들어주는 서비스로 발전하고 있습니다.

루빗은 21년 10월 피봇팅 이후 1년 만에 누적 10만 명의 유저를 만들었어요.
22년 11월 미국 출시 반년 만에 15만 명의 해외 유저를 모았어요! (오가닉비율 95%)
23년 9월 남미권 출시 이후 급격하게 성장해서 누적 230만 유저를 달성했어요 (오가닉비율 99%)
이제 현지화를 통해 미국 뿐만 아니라 170개국으로 글로벌 확장을 준비하고 있어요:)

• 누적 230만 유저 달성
• Google Play ‘올해를 빛낸 자기계발 앱’ 선정
• '루틴' 플레이스토어 1위 달성 (한국,브라질,멕시코)
• '습관' 플레이스토어 2위 달성 (한국,브라질,멕시코)

이러한 성장이 가능한 이유는 루빗은 철저히 [고객 / 데이터 중심]으로 의사결정을 하기 때문입니다

그 외에도 7억 규모 연구개발과제인 TIPS과제 뿐만 아니라 구글플레이 올해를 빛낸 앱 선정,
구글플레이 창구, IBK 창공, 창업도약패키지 선정 등 외부에서 성과를 인정받고 있습니다.

저희와 짜릿한 성장을 함께할 동료를 찾고 있어요.

주요업무

[루빗에서 프론트엔드 개발자를 해야하는 이유]

루빗은 이렇게 일해요
• 유저 기반 의사결정: 정말 유저가 좋아하고 사랑할 수 있는 앱 서비스를 만들기 위해 VoC에 항상 귀 기울이고 측정합니다.
• 작업자 의사결정 존중: 각 팀원의 전문성과 의견을 존중하며, 다양한 관점을 수렴해 최적의 결정을 추구합니다.
• 데이터 기반 의사결정: 좋은 의사결정을 위해 데이터를 활용합니다. AB테스트, 고객 요구, 제품 지표 등을 분석하여 객관적인 정보에 기반한 결정을 내립니다.

이런 경험과 성장을 할 수 있어요
• 글로벌 최적화 경험: 글로벌 사용자를 위한 저성능 기기에서 앱 서비스를 최적화합니다.
• 인터렉션 및 애니메이션 경험: Lottie, RIVE 등을 통해 애니메이션을 구현하고 최적화해요.
• 즉각적인 피드백: 기능을 배포하고 글로벌 유저의 피드백과 칭찬을 즉각적으로 받는 재미가 있어요.
• 훌륭한 동료들과 협업: 각 분야의 전문성 있는 동료들에게 조언을 얻을 수 있어요. 혼자 고민하기보다 함께 논의하고 구체화해요.
• 주도적인 업무를 위한 적극적인 지원: 업무와 성장에 필요한 비금전적 및 금전적 지원을 아끼지 않습니다.
• 데이터 기반 성과 피드백: 스프린트 단위로 데이터 분석가와 협력하여 성과를 정량적으로 분석하고 공유합니다. 내가 만든 기능에 대한 효용감을 크게 느낄 수 있어요.



[프론트엔드 개발자로서 해야하는 업무에요]

1. 앱 기능 개발 및 배포
: 스프린트마다 업데이트를 위한 신규 기능 개발, 기존기능 고도화를 진행해요.
: websocket, GRPC 등 실시간 통신 프로토콜을 활용하여, 실시간 AI Agent를 개발해요.
2. 앱 성능 시스템 개선
: Sentry 등을 활용해 저성능 디바이스에서 성능을 측정하고 최적화해요.
3. 앱 내 애니메이션 고도화
: Lottie 기반 3D 벡터기반 애니메이션이 많아요. react-native-skia, reanimated, Rive를 통해 애니메이션을 구현하고 개선해요.
: 영상, 이미지 미디어의 트렌젝션을 구현하고 최적화를 해요.
4. 오류 및 크래시 개선
: Firebase Crashlytics, Sentry 등을 통해 원인을 빠르게 찾고 해결합니다.
: Native 개발이 필요할 경우, 직접 개선하거나 파트타이머와 소통하여 해결합니다.

[선택 업무: 개인의 역량과 선호에 따라 Advanced 업무를 가져갈 수 있어요]

1. 안드로이드, iOS 네이티브 기능 브릿지 모듈 구현
: 기존 라이브러리로 해결이 안되는 문제는 직접 네이티브 코드 개선을 통해 해결해요.
2. 온디바이스 AI모델 서빙
: 앱 내 필요한 온디바이스 AI 모델을 onnx 기반으로 적용하고 성능을 최적화 해요.

[주요 개발 환경]
• Front-end, Back-end: 모두 Typescript를 사용해요.
• Mobile App: React Native와 React Webview(NextJS)로 개발해요.
• 빠른 앱 배포를 위해 CodePush와 Fastlane을 도입해 사용하고 있어요.

[기술스택]
• 프론트 스택
- Typescript
- React-Native
- Next.js
- Tanstack-query
- Zustand
- Vercel
• 백엔드 스택
- NestJS
- Golang
- AWS
- GCP
- Kafka
- Kubernetes
- Redis
- PostgreSQL
- DynamoDB

자격요건

• React-Native를 활용한 앱 서비스 개발 전문성
• Javascript에 대한 깊은 이해
• React, Next.js에 대한 깊은 이해
• Webview로 개발한 경험
• iOS, Android 모듈을 개발하고 적용한 경험
• 저성능 기기 최적화 경험
• 4년 이상 혹은 이에 준하는 경력을 가진 사람 **(경력보다 어떤 경험을 했는지를 중요하게 생각합니다)**
• 코드리뷰를 통해 팀 성장에 기여하며, 클린코드를 좋아하는 분
• 레거시 코드를 수정하여 유지보수를 통해 서비스 개선 경험이 있는 분
• 상호 존중하는 커뮤니케이션을 중요하게 생각하는 분

기술 스택 • 툴

태그

마감일

상시채용

근무지역

서울 영등포구 의사당대로 83, 위워크 4층 110호
본 채용정보는 원티드랩의 동의없이 무단전재, 재배포, 재가공할 수 없으며, 구직활동 이외의 용도로 사용할 수 없습니다.

본 채용 정보는 에서 제공한 자료를 바탕으로 원티드랩에서 표현을 수정하고 이의 배열 및 구성을 편집하여 완성한 원티드랩의 저작자산이자 영업자산입니다. 본 정보 및 데이터베이스의 일부 내지는 전부에 대하여 원티드랩의 동의 없이 무단전재 또는 재배포, 재가공 및 크롤링할 수 없으며, 게재된 채용기업의 정보는 구직자의 구직활동 이외의 용도로 사용될 수 없습니다. 원티드랩은 에서 게재한 자료에 대한 오류나 그 밖에 원티드랩이 가공하지 않은 정보의 내용상 문제에 대하여 어떠한 보장도 하지 않으며, 사용자가 이를 신뢰하여 취한 조치에 대해 책임을 지지 않습니다.
<저작권자 (주)원티드랩. 무단전재-재배포금지>